Job DescriptionThe Registered Cardiac/Vascular Technologist is responsible for the administration of high frequency sound waves and other diagnostic techniques for medical purposes at the request of, and for interpretation by a licensed independent practitioner. This position requires a highly skilled and competent professional who is considered to be an integral part of the health care team. Must be able to demonstrate an understanding of human anatomy, physiology, pathology, and medical terminology. Is expected to be competent in production, use, recognition and analysis of ultrasound images and patterns used for patient diagnosis and treatment.
